CT-6EV502 Equivalent & Substitute Parts

Part Overview

The CT-6EV502 is a 5 kOhm 0.5W through-hole trimmer potentiometer manufactured by Nidec Components Corporation. This cermet-based trimmer features PC pin termination, top adjustment, and a square form factor (7.00mm x 7.00mm). The part is active in production status and maintains full RoHS3 compliance. Key Parameters

Parameter Specification
Resistance Value 5 kOhms
Power Rating 0.5W (1/2W)
Tolerance ±10%
Temperature Coefficient ±100ppm/°C
Number of Turns 1
Adjustment Type Top Adjustment
Resistive Material Cermet
Mounting Type Through Hole
Termination Style PC Pins
RoHS Status ROHS3 Compliant

Substitute Part Grouping Explanation

Substitution eligibility for the CT-6EV502 is determined by strict equivalence across the following critical parameters: resistance value (5 kOhms), power rating (0.5W), tolerance (±10%), temperature coefficient (±100ppm/°C), number of turns (1), adjustment type (top adjustment), resistive material (cermet), mounting type (through hole), and termination style (PC pins). All identified substitute parts meet these core electrical and mechanical requirements. Physical form factor variations (square versus round) and packaging differences (bulk versus tube) do not affect functional substitution within circuit applications where PCB layout accommodates the alternative dimensions.

Parameter Comparison

Parameter CT-6EV502 (Nidec) 3329H-1-502LF (Bourns) 72PR5KLF (TT Electronics) 82PR5KLF (TT Electronics) T73YE502KT20 (Vishay)
Resistance 5 kOhms 5 kOhms 5 kOhms 5 kOhms 5 kOhms
Power Rating 0.5W 0.5W 0.5W 0.5W 0.5W
Tolerance ±10% ±10% ±10% ±10% ±10%
Temperature Coefficient ±100ppm/°C ±100ppm/°C ±100ppm/°C ±100ppm/°C ±100ppm/°C
Number of Turns 1 1 1.0 1.0 1.0
Adjustment Type Top Adjustment Top Adjustment Top Adjustment Top Adjustment Top Adjustment
Resistive Material Cermet Cermet Cermet Cermet Cermet
Mounting Type Through Hole Through Hole Through Hole Through Hole Through Hole
Termination Style PC Pins PC Pins PC Pins PC Pins PC Pins
Form Factor Square 7.00mm x 7.00mm Round 6.35mm Dia Square 9.53mm x 9.53mm Round 6.35mm Dia Rectangular 7.00mm x 6.60mm
Product Status Active Active Active Active Active
RoHS Status ROHS3 Compliant ROHS3 Compliant ROHS3 Compliant ROHS3 Compliant ROHS3 Compliant

Engineering Selection Recommendations

All substitute parts listed maintain active production status and full ROHS3 compliance, ensuring regulatory alignment with the CT-6EV502. The 3329H-1-502LF (Bourns Trimpot® 3329 series) and 82PR5KLF (TT Electronics 82 series) feature identical round form factors at 6.35mm diameter, minimizing PCB layout modifications. The 72PR5KLF (TT Electronics 72 series) provides a larger square footprint at 9.53mm x 9.53mm, suitable for applications with expanded board space. The T73YE502KT20 (Vishay Sfernice T73 series) offers a rectangular profile closely matching the original CT-6EV502 dimensions. Selection should prioritize form factor compatibility with existing PCB designs and lead time availability from the preferred supplier.

Frequently Asked Questions (FAQ)

Q: Can the 3329H-1-502LF substitute for the CT-6EV502 in all applications? A: Yes, the 3329H-1-502LF meets all electrical specifications (5 kOhms, 0.5W, ±10% tolerance, ±100ppm/°C). The round 6.35mm form factor differs from the square 7.00mm original, requiring verification that PCB hole spacing and layout accommodate the alternative geometry.

Q: What is the primary difference between the 72PR5KLF and 82PR5KLF? A: Both parts are manufactured by TT Electronics/BI with identical electrical specifications. The 72PR5KLF features a square form factor (9.53mm x 9.53mm), while the 82PR5KLF uses a round form factor (6.35mm diameter). Selection depends on available PCB space and mounting hole configuration.

Q: Are all substitute parts RoHS3 compliant? A: Yes, all listed substitute parts carry ROHS3 compliance certification, matching the regulatory status of the CT-6EV502.

Q: Does packaging format (bulk versus tube) affect electrical performance? A: No, packaging format does not affect electrical or mechanical performance. Bulk and tube packaging represent different distribution methods for the same component specifications.

Q: Which substitute offers the closest physical match to the CT-6EV502? A: The T73YE502KT20 (Vishay Sfernice) provides the closest dimensional match with a rectangular form factor of 7.00mm x 6.60mm, compared to the original 7.00mm x 7.00mm square profile.
